Managed by the National Youth Agency, the Environment Now programme is funded by O2 and the National Lottery through the Big Lottery Fund and is part of the ‘Our Bright Future’ programme.
Grants of up to £10,000 are available for young people between the ages of 17 and 24 years for projects that use digital technology to find innovative solutions to pressing environmental issues. This could be, for example, improving energy efficiency, reducing waste, or recycling.
Although the total amount of the grant is £10,000, only £8,300 is available for project costs as £1,200 is to be used to help cover travel costs to events, and 5% of the £10,000 is kept as a retention fee which the grant recipient will receive after successfully completing four project milestones.
In addition to the funding, the programme will provide successful applicants with mentoring, work experience and insight sessions with industry professionals to help bring their ideas to life.
